Motorists leaving the Cape Town CBD on Sunday won't be able to use the elevated freeway.
The road between Walter Sisulu and the N1/N2 split will be closed to traffic.
The City of Cape Town said its teams will carry out maintenance on the electronic message boards used to update motorists on traffic alerts.
MMC for Urban Mobility Rob Quintas said motorists will have to use alternative routes to leave the city.
"On Sunday, the 21st of Septembe,r the outbound elevated freeway between Walter Sisulu and the N1/N2 split will be closed from 04:00 until midday for essential maintenance on the electronic message boards. Part of Heerengracht Street and FW de Klerk Boulevard will also be affected.”
